2010/8/10 Tom Lane <t...@sss.pgh.pa.us>: > Eventually it might be nice to have some sort of way to specify the > estimate to use for any aggregate function --- but for a near-term > fix maybe we should just hard-wire a special case for array_agg in > count_agg_clauses_walker().
The attached patch is the near-term fix; it adds ALLOCSET_DEFAULT_INITSIZE bytes to memory assumption. We might need the same adjustment for string_agg(), that consumes 1024 bytes for the transit condition. array_agg() and string_agg() are only aggregates that have "internal" for aggtranstype. -- Itagaki Takahiro
